The above, will, in my opinion, be little more than average.
Why ?
Project Gotham 2 - only so much you can do with the licence and apart from flashier graphics and Xbox Live - which by the way I'm sick of reading OXM's opinion that Live ability makesa crap game good - there is little room for improvement.
Conker - it's the N64 version rehashed. Rare seems - from what they have released - to have lost their flare.
Driver 3 - too late and too long in development
True Crime - tries to emulate GTA but you can't beat the original franchise.
Doom 3 - too long in development and Half Life 2 / Halo 2 will overshadow it anyway.
Shenmue 3 - because a game with more cinematics and speech than MGS2 is not the way forward - Shenmue 2 hardly set the sales charts on fire did it ?
Tony Hawk's - unless there is serious innovation then....average.
